Thailand has reached an agreement with Iran regarding the passage of its oil tankers through the Strait of Hormuz
Thai Prime Minister Anutin announced today that in response to the crisis caused by rising domestic oil prices due to the situation in the Middle East, the Thai Ministry of Foreign Affairs has been actively communicating with relevant countries. According to the agreement reached with Iran, Thai tankers can safely pass through the Strait of Hormuz.
Anutin held a media briefing at the Government House that day to explain the government's measures to address oil price fluctuations. He stated that the government will focus on advancing four areas of work: diplomatic coordination, energy security, commodity price control, and ensuring the livelihood of the people, and called on the public to jointly implement energy-saving measures to respond.
Thai Foreign Minister Sihasak stated that Thailand has proposed to hold a special ASEAN Foreign Ministers' meeting to discuss solutions to ease tensions. Thailand currently has stable oil reserves, and the government is actively seeking additional energy sources through diplomatic channels.
